The other day I started a new study guide, and the first lesson was on Genesis 1. It is incredible the amount of knowledge we can glean from the very first chapters of the bible. And the best part is everything we learn about God is as current now as it was at the beginning of the world, because God never changes! First of all we learn that God already existed before the world did. Its impossible for us to comprehend such an amazing fact, because we have brains that are finite. The bible warns us to "lean not on your own understanding" and states throughout that God's ways are above our ways. BUT, the good news is God has placed "eternity in our hearts" so that while we dont understand with our minds, we know instinctively within our hearts that it is true. The second thing we learn is that God is in control. Not just of us as people, but in control of every single element. He commands the light, the waters, the earth's rotation and orbit, every single thing so that He could create the universe exactly how He wanted it to be. That kind of power is truly mind boggling, and I know I stand in awe of that kind of ability! But there is also great comfort in knowing that God is all powerful. Our little woes and cares may seem HUGE in our own eyes, but in reality when you stack them up against the existence of the universe they're not so big! In fact, they're so temporary that in comparison with eternity they are NOTHING! God can handle ANYTHING we throw at Him and infinately more because He knows us INTIMATELY! He created us, and He knows our innermost workings.
Take a watchmaker as an example. A watch is a surprisingly complex piece of machinery that often we take for granted, but there is amazing workings going on inside. The watchmaker who made that watch knows each little individual part intimately.....how it works and what each piece is meant to do. So, when something goes wrong with the watch, the watchmaker can figure out which piece is not doing its part, and either replace or repair it back to working order again. So it is the same with God.....if there is something wrong with us, spiritually or physically, God knows what needs to happen. If we're struggling with something spiritual God knows how to either replace that part of our lives or repair it to working order, and if there's something wrong physically God knows how to get us help or give us strength to deal with the problem. In fact, there is noone more qualified to deal with our problems than the one who created everything! BUT, the catch is, just like the owner of the watch has to hand it over to the watchmaker for repair, so we must also hand our lives over to the creator of all things to make right.
